The Medium-Frequency Induction Smelting Furnace is widely regarded for its power to melt metals proficiently utilizing electromagnetic induction ideas. This technology generates warmth specifically inside the metal cost, permitting for swift and uniform melting. The Medium-Frequency Induction Smelting Furnace is usually Utilized in foundries, metal plants, and steel processing amenities the place exact temperature Command and higher-high quality steel generation are necessary. Its efficiency and reliability make it a favored Alternative for manufacturers generating numerous grades of metal, Solid iron, copper alloys, aluminum items, and specialty metals.

One of many critical advantages of a Medium-Frequency Induction Smelting Furnace is its capability to deliver superb Electricity effectiveness in comparison with many traditional melting solutions. Due to the fact heat is generated instantly throughout the metal, Strength losses are minimized. This contributes to reduced operational costs although keeping regular merchandise good quality. Also, the engineering delivers diminished emissions and cleaner Performing ailments, rendering it a lovely choice for providers centered on environmental obligation and sustainable producing procedures.

A further vital technological innovation in modern day steelmaking is the Electric Arc Furnace. This furnace utilizes potent electric powered arcs in between graphite electrodes as well as steel demand to generate the intensive heat needed for melting. The Electric Arc Furnace has become Just about the most extensively utilised techniques for steel recycling and manufacturing as it can efficiently course of action scrap steel into significant-top quality metal products and solutions. Its versatility makes it possible for manufacturers to adjust manufacturing As outlined by current market requires whilst maintaining large efficiency amounts.

The Electric Arc Furnace presents a number of Gains that lead to its widespread adoption. It provides speedier melting cycles, decreased dependence on raw iron ore, and bigger Handle over chemical composition. These benefits make the Electric Arc Furnace a crucial component of sustainable metal output. By employing recycled scrap metal, makers can reduce source intake and lessen the environmental impact connected with regular steelmaking approaches.

Besides melting technologies, refining processes Participate in a significant role in obtaining remarkable steel top quality. The LF/VD/VOD Refining Furnace is especially designed to greatly enhance the purity and efficiency properties of molten steel. LF stands for Ladle Furnace, VD refers to Vacuum Degassing, and VOD signifies Vacuum Oxygen Decarburization. With each other, these refining systems supply in depth remedies for getting rid of impurities, controlling alloy composition, and improving upon metallurgical Attributes.

The LF/VD/VOD Refining Furnace is particularly significant for generating significant-grade steels Utilized in demanding programs such as aerospace, automotive producing, energy creation, and significant equipment. By way of State-of-the-art refining approaches, suppliers can obtain exact chemical specifications and exceptional mechanical Attributes. The power on the LF/VD/VOD Refining Furnace to reduce unwelcome gases and impurities substantially enhances products excellent and reliability.

Another significant furnace program Employed in metallurgical operations is definitely the Submerged Arc Furnace. This specialized furnace is usually employed for developing ferroalloys, silicon metal, calcium carbide, and many industrial materials. Unlike Several other furnace technologies, the Submerged Arc Furnace operates with electrodes submerged in the raw product charge, letting electrical Power being transformed immediately into thermal Electricity within the reaction zone.

The Submerged Arc Furnace is extremely valued for its power to process massive portions of Uncooked materials successfully. Industries that demand ferroalloy manufacturing usually rely upon the Submerged Arc Furnace as a result of its capability to maintain large temperatures and aid elaborate reduction reactions. Its sturdy structure and high productiveness ensure it is a crucial asset in many metallurgical facilities globally.
